Been reading the posts for awhile and decided to log in and help answer some of this stuff.

Re Visa - the regs state that a bank can only acquire payments from merchants located within their domicile (i.e. US bank - US merchant, EU bank - EU merchant, etc) so you won't find an actual US processor that CAN sign up a Non US merchant. #rd Party and IPSP is a bit different - can explain that later if you want.

There are only a couple of banks in US that you can get an actual adult merchant account through - same with EU, Asia, etc. Most of the rest is going through all those others as have been mentioned and they all are under the scutiny of the card associations right now - no matter where they are located and if they charged a registration fee or not.

Directfiesta - Aggregators can take cross border in all categories all day long - the relationship is between THEM and THIER bank - doesn't matter where the "merchant" is and doesn't matter if its adult or not.
